- [ ] Recon job key rotation (release manager): Before we seal the new signing keys for the Stockfall inventory reconciliation job, make sure the old ones are revoked in the Quorale vault — yes, even the "temporary" ones from last quarter's migration. Once revoked, the recon scheduler will demand re-enrollment on its next run, which is expected. Keep the witness in the room until this step is done. Re-enroll using the passphrase below.

unlock words, yawig-kagef: gordor-holvan-ulaael-pramir-ulaiel-tamdor

# Contact: Upstream Breaker

The Corvalt gateway wraps the Nimberline API behind a circuit breaker. Plugin authors: do not retry past an open breaker; back off 60s. Breaker thresholds are not configurable per plugin. Status is published on the Corvalt dev portal. Config bugs go to the gateway team; everything else to plugin support. For breaker incidents, write to the address below.

escalation mailbox, yafog-kafof: eliok@xolmarcloud.local

Quarterly Planning Note — Capacity, Drayfell Works. Sales leads should note that the Drayfell plant is approved for a second shift beginning next quarter, lifting output on the Morrow valve range by an estimated 30%. Lead times should shorten from nine weeks to six by mid-quarter; please avoid committing to faster dates until confirmed. Allocation priorities remain unchanged for existing accounts. The strategic reasoning is recorded below.

management briefing: Headcount on the Quenael team goes from 9 to 80 by the end of July. Gross margin on Quenael came in at 15 percent against a plan of 20 percent.

// MAX_TOUR_SEGMENTS caps audio segments per exhibit tour in the
// Hallwick Gallery guide app. Raising this past 48 breaks the
// offline prefetcher on low-end devices; confirmed during the
// Vexhall release cycle. Do not change without a load test sign-off.
// Release manager: pin this constant per build and verify against
// the manifest. The associated build token follows directly below.

session token of yajof-bagef = htk4_937d